CIVCOM Announces the Launch of the World Smallest Tunable Optical Dispersion Compensator (TODC)
Mar 04, 2005

Petah-Tikva, Israel, March 4, 2005 – Civcom® (http://www.civcom.com), a pioneer in the development and manufacturing of tunable transponders and solid-state optical switches, announced today the launch of TODC - the world’s smallest Tunable Optical Dispersion Compensator. The TODC, which can be integrated into 300PIN MSA transponders for extending their reach, will be displayed at OFC/NFOEC 2005 exhibition, stand # 1115.

TODC, which is based on Civcom’s unique SFS (Solid Free Space) technology, covers the full C or L-band windows with narrow channel spacing (25GHz or higher) and exhibits less than 2 dB insertion loss. The low cost TODC is fully tunable, and is characterized by low power consumption. Civcom's TODC is available in a standard butterfly package size and is capable of a dispersion tuning range up to +/- 1700ps/nm and supports rates of up to 12.5Gbps.

Civcom's TODC is designed for single and multi-channel compensation as well as fiber emulation applications. The new product features the most cost effective solution for Metro and Long Reach optical networks, and is also available as a stand-alone unit.

Prof. David Mendlovic, Civcom’s CEO says:” The integration of an optical dispersion compensator in Civcom's standard 300PIN MSA tunable transponder extends its reach to 200km+ using standard NRZ modulation. This allows carriers to simplify their system and reduce its cost.”

The TODC butterfly package is under evaluation with selected tier-1 customers, and is now available in production volumes.
